  • Patent number: 11117146
    Abstract: A spray system for an agricultural machine is configured to include a valving arrangement and multiple liquid product lines coupled to spray nozzle assemblies such that the valving arrangement can connect the product lines to the spray nozzle assemblies in different ways to achieve different modes of operation. Such modes can include providing agricultural liquid product flow through the spray nozzle assemblies at differing rates and/or flushing the product through the spray nozzle assemblies in differing directions. This can be achieved by controlling the valving arrangement to selectively connect any of the lines to pump for supplying product, to tank for returning product, or to block the lines to inhibit the flow of product. In one aspect, the product multiple lines can be of different sizes to enable more modes of operation, such as greater or lesser flow rates while spraying.

  • Patent number: 10933742
    Abstract: An alternative traction control system, in addition to a primary traction control system, is associated with an agricultural machine in which a user selectable input can allow wheels of an the agricultural machine to spin freely, such as for clearing debris from tires, until a predetermined deactivate condition occurs. Such a deactivate condition could comprise, for example, reaching a maximum rotation speed and/or temperature threshold with respect to a wheel. To minimize the risk of damage to propulsion components which may be caused by excessive rotation speeds and/or temperatures, upon reaching such a threshold, operation can return from the alternative traction control system to the primary traction control system. Such a system can therefore allow an “on the fly” change that would permit an operator to selectively spin the tires without damaging mechanical aspects of the agricultural machine.

  • Publication number: 20200390080
    Abstract: A boom truss structure for an agricultural sprayer that includes boom segments on either side of the sprayer, including primary boom segments, secondary boom segments attached to the primary boom segments at a first hinge, and breakaway boom segments attached to the secondary boom segments at a second hinge. The primary boom segment includes truss elements extending upwardly from a base support member. The secondary boom also includes a base support member, but with an inverted underside truss support member that is located underneath the base support member instead of on top of the base support member. This allows the secondary boom segment to fold on top of the primary boom segment in a compact manner about a lower pivot axis. Additionally, the breakaway boom segment may be folded initially about the secondary boom segment, after which the secondary boom segment is folded about the primary boom segment.
